Votives with a Baker's Twine Twist

Twine-wrapped votive holders are perfect for your mantel, or as an easy centerpiece. I filled mine with sweet, white daisies!

Materials Needed:

Twine from The Twinery (I used Charcoal)
votive holders
flowers or candles
The how-to for this is super simple:
Take the twine of your choice, and wrap around your glass votive holders. When you have wrapped to the desired effect, cut and knot!

So simple and so easy-that's my kind of crafting!
